Global Gantry (Cartesian) Robot Market (USD Million), 2020 - 2030
In the year 2023, the Global Gantry (Cartesian) Robot Market was valued at USD 17,389.54 million.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 33,040.40 million by the year 2030,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 9.6%.
Gantry robots, also known as cartesian or linear robots, refer to large systems composed of a manipulator attached to an overhead system that allows movement over a horizontal plane. These robots are also utilized in welding and other industries such as the automobile and food and beverage industries. The gantry robot is used to hold and position a wide range of end-effectors, including those used in PC board assembly, dispensing, spraying, material handling, assembling, packing, unitizing, sorting, scanning, and tray. The main types of gantry robots are open gantry robots and closed gantry robots. The open gantry robot is used to move heavy loads dynamically, quickly, and precisely. An open gantry robot refers to a system containing just one X-beam, and a carriage plate that supports a YZ2-axis robot rides on this beam. An open gantry has the advantage of utilizing less plant capacity and providing greater flexibility to suit the workflow. The different payloads include less than 50 kg, 51–350 kg, and more than 350 kg. The several applications include factory automation, miscellaneous manufacturing, packaging machinery, and others. The various industries include automotive, electrical and electronics, metals and machinery, plastics, rubber, and chemicals, food and beverages, precision engineering and optics, pharmaceuticals and cosmetics, and others.

Safety Concerns - Safety concerns are a critical consideration in the global gantry (cartesian) robot market, as these robotic systems operate in diverse industrial environments alongside human workers. Gantry robots, known for their precision, speed, and versatility, are employed across various industries for tasks such as material handling, assembly, packaging, and welding. However, the interaction between humans and robots in shared workspaces presents inherent safety risks that must be addressed to ensure the well-being of workers and the efficient operation of production facilities. One of the primary safety concerns associated with gantry robots is the risk of collisions or contact between the robot and human operators or other equipment. To mitigate these risks, safety features such as sensors, vision systems, and protective barriers are integrated into gantry robot systems to detect and prevent potential accidents.
Collaborative robot (cobot) technologies enable gantry robots to work safely alongside human workers, employing features such as force and speed limiting, as well as real-time monitoring to ensure safe interaction. Proper training and education for operators and maintenance personnel are essential to ensure the safe operation of gantry robots. Workers need to be aware of safety protocols, emergency procedures, and best practices for working in proximity to robotic systems. Regular maintenance and inspection of gantry robots are also critical to identify and address any potential safety hazards or malfunctions promptly. Regulatory standards and guidelines, such as ISO 10218 for industrial robots and ISO/TS 15066 for collaborative robots, provide frameworks for ensuring the safety of gantry robot systems. Compliance with these standards helps manufacturers and end-users mitigate safety risks and demonstrate their commitment to maintaining a safe working environment.
